我们提供学生信息管理系统招投标所需全套资料,包括学工系统介绍PPT、学生管理系统产品解决方案、
学生管理系统产品技术参数,以及对应的标书参考文件,详请联系客服。
随着信息技术的发展,学工管理系统的建设已成为提高教育管理水平的重要手段。本文旨在探讨如何使用Java Web技术开发一个高效、实用的学工管理系统,并着重于该系统在浙江省的应用情况。
首先,我们从需求分析开始,确定了系统需要实现的功能模块,包括学生信息管理、教师信息管理、课程安排、成绩管理等。接下来是系统的设计阶段,包括数据库设计与后端逻辑设计。以下是部分数据库表的设计:

CREATE TABLE Student (
student_id INT PRIMARY KEY,
name VARCHAR(50),
gender CHAR(1),
birth_date DATE,
major VARCHAR(50)
);
CREATE TABLE Course (
course_id INT PRIMARY KEY,
course_name VARCHAR(50),
credit INT,
teacher_id INT,
FOREIGN KEY (teacher_id) REFERENCES Teacher(teacher_id)
);
在后端逻辑设计中,我们采用了Spring框架进行业务逻辑处理,并结合MyBatis进行数据库操作。以下是一个简单的数据查询示例:
@Service
public class StudentService {
@Autowired
private StudentMapper studentMapper;
public List<Student> getAllStudents() {
return studentMapper.selectAll();
}
}
最后,前端界面采用HTML、CSS与JavaScript实现,通过Ajax技术实现了异步数据交互,提高了用户体验。
该系统已在浙江省多所高校部署并运行良好,得到了师生的一致好评。未来,我们将继续优化系统功能,进一步提升教育管理的效率与质量。